I have an AEF30 from 2004 (I believe) that my wife bought me before we were married (what was she thinking?) Serial E 04023323 it was bought new from Musician's Friend.

Anyways, the onboard preamp is AEQ SSR. I've had a ton of issues with it over the years. The solder job was poor to begin with. It clicked, it popped, it frequently dropped out during live performances.

Don't get me wrong, I absolutely love how the guitar sounds, I just hate to be so offput by the stupid preamp. I'm curious if anyone else has issues with this preamp and what you wound up doing? Mine just cut out again and isn't working at all. I checked the solder points on the XLR input and everything looks fine but I can't see the area that's a heap of hot glue on the 1/4" input and assume there is a broken wire in there. The Warranty on Electronics for all our instruments is 1 year from the date of purchase...so unfortunately you are outside of warranty...

I can advise you as to how to get replacement parts let me know if you are interested in that.

I do however need to know if you have an AEF30E or a just plain AEF30 and also the color code if available...different colors were made in different years

basically there are a number of preamps that you could need and the only way to be sure is to provide a bit more information

My first guess (since you said AEQ SSR) is the 5AEQ27F which is still available and has a list price of $124.99

For that year and model the 5AEQ27F is the correct preamp.

The only reason you would need to replace the pickup too is if that is also not working...I may suggest taking it somewhere and having it tested...

Does the preamp turn on and is just not getting a read? (Pickup may be bad, output jack may be bad)

or is the preamp not turning on, but when it does it works? (Preamp is bad)

the problem is it could be any of three components depending

5AEQ27F - Preamp - not turning on, even with new battery

5APU10F - Pickup - only needed if not responding to string vibration...You can only really test this if the preamp is working. Remove the saddle, Plug the instrument in and tap the pickup lightly with something metal, you will hear a noise through the amp if both the preamp and pickup are working.

5AJK05F - Output Jack - if Preamp is coming on, but yet no sound - this is what you would check first as it has the least cost to it.
